Why Parental Involvement Matters in Preschool

Profound effects on students’ lives are offered, but only for a long time as they engage their parents during preschool: 

  • School-Related Benefits: Children with wiser and knowledgeable parents manifest curiosity, better language development, and skills at school. 
  • Emotional and Social Skills: Children acquire emotional control, receive higher self-esteem scores, and have better peer interactions when the parents engage themselves in the regular activities involving children in preschools. 
  • Affirmative Motivation Towards Learning: The students will become motivated learners since the children recognize their parents’ interest in their education.

  1. Parental Workshops and Seminars

The DGS preschool advocates for parents’ empowerment with knowledge and resources to have stronger learning outcomes for children. Regular workshops are organized for parents to address topics like

  • Effective parenting skills
  • Nutrition and health of children
  • Emotional intelligence and child psychology
  • Promoting early reading and numeracy skills at home

Such workshops help parents be better partners in guiding their child’s learning outside the classroom.
